deep1985 said:
Guys,
It's Decision Made.
Received passport request on 13/05/15.

Some points to share-
Thanks for this forum and seniors who have been through all these stages before us and who are following.
1. App filed 3/7/14.
2. Lived in UK from 2008 to 2011 and obtained PCC after filing my application. So sent that PCC with MR on 17/4/15. It has been accepted.
3. Indian PCC asked again with MR. So submitted fresh one.
4. Paid fees through credit card. Easy and fasten your processing.
5. Worked at 3 jobs. Provided offer letters, experience letters and tax documents for latest job.
6. Provided information for months when I was not working or looking for job too/part time work in UK.
7. Single applicant.
8. File prepared by consultant.
9. Medicals done on e medical, centre. Ludhiana.
10. Indian PCC - obtained one only although worked at 3 locations.
Hope it will help to following friends in same line.

karunya.vemulapalli said:
Just wanted to update my complete Timelines:
Today we received our Passport with Visa/COPR



03-Jul-14 - Couriour Sent (Blue Dart)
09-Jul-14 - Application Received at CIC Canada
27-Oct-14 - DD Encashed
05-Nov-14 - PER Received
10-Jan-15 - Medicals Received
22-Jan-15 - Medicals Completed.
29-Jan-15 - Medicals sent by Hospital.
30-Jan-15 - Medicals have been received updated.
09-Mar-15 - Received a call from NDVO asking if we wanted to extend one of our passport which was eixpiring or if we wanted the stamping on existing passport. We choose to extend the passport.
12-Mar-15 - Went for Passport Renewal (Normal Passport).
14-Mar-15 - Police physical address verification for Passport
16-Mar-15 - Passport Office received police verification report.
17-Mar-15 - Passport Printed.
18-Mar-15 - Passport Dispatched.
19-Mar-15 - Passport notary copies dispatched to NDVO
20-Mar-15 - Passport notary copies Received at NDVO
30-Mar-15 - Emailed NDVO asking if the document reached.
23-Apr-15 - Got a reply from NDVO, that the documents reached.
11-May-15 - Received PPR and Passports submitted at VFS @ Hyderabad, India
12-May-15 - "A decision has been made on your application. The office will contact you concerning this decision." - Updated
15-May-15 - Picked the Passport from VFS office.


Total Duration (Days): 316 Days
Days Since PER: 191 Days
Day Since Process Started (NDVO): 129 Days
Days Since Medicals Request Received: 125 Days
Days Since Medicals Done: 113 Days
Days Since Medicals/RPRF/PCC Posted: 106 Days
Days Since Medicals Received (eCAS Update): 105 Days
Days since we received call from NDVO (For passport extension): 67 Days
Days Since new passport copies reached: 56 Days
Days since PPR received: 4 Days
Days since Visa/COPR Received: 0 Days

Hi Buddy,

DON'T get tensed.....the key is to remain calm and confident....Many ppl have successfully cleared it including some from ur NOC this year...Particularly ur NOC seems to be a favorite for interview...If ur docs for work-ex, education, etc are all genuine, you have nothing to fear...


DO these things->

1. Apply for GCMS Notes immediately, it will help u determine why an Interview has been called..I presume ur Interview Date is 45 days from now...U shud get ur Notes in 30...

arkscan said:
Dude,

Only the CC Card-holder's name would be there on the final receipt (PDF generated after online payment) with blank fields for Applicant UCI, Address, DOB, etc...You need to take a print of the receipt, fill in your details by pen and send the receipt to NDVO...
